    I see I'm not the only one to which this premise creates not a whole lot of interest.

    PIXAR's next movie is called Ratatouille and is about "the adventures of a rat named Ratatouille who lives in an extremely fancy restaurant in Paris overseen by an eccentric, world-famous chef." The cast is rumored to feature "the voice talents of: Brad Garrett as Chef, Kate Beckinsale as Esemhones, Jimmy Fallon as Frloen, Jeffrey Tambor as Banas, Harrison Ford as The Evil Andws, John Ratzenberger as Eskoimes, Martin Short as Nemral, Patrick Warburton as Wean and Bill Fagerbakke as Featner."

    I think I'm already more excited about that one. But still, I'm sure Cars will be good, but I'm also sure I'm not going to see it in theaters and probably won't buy the dvd.
